What it mean to seduce someone?

What it mean to seduce someone?

1 : to persuade to disobedience or disloyalty. 2 : to lead astray usually by persuasion or false promises. 3 : to carry out the physical seduction of : entice to sexual intercourse. 4 : attract.

Is seduction a bad word?

How is seduction used in real life? Seduction often has a somewhat negative connotation that implies that such actions are devious and manipulative. It's very commonly used in reference to sex, but it's also commonly used in a general way.

What is the difference between flirting and seducing?

Seducing is also used figuratively to mean to get someone to give in to anything they're trying not to do, most often a vice or temptation. So flirting with someone and hitting on someone are typical actions taken in the process of seducing them.
